USA leads as top export destination for Pakistan in November

December 18, 2023 (MLN): The U. S. A. remained the top export destination for Pakistan during November FY24, with $435.14 million worth of shipments, down by 7.89% YoY against the exports of $472.4m in the same period last year.

According to the data released by the State Bank of Pakistan, this was followed by China, as Pakistan exported goods worth $271.32m from the country as compared to the exports of $199.06m recorded during the same month of the previous year, depicting a rise of 36.3% YoY.

U. K. was the third on the list as Pakistan generated export revenue worth $172.94m from the country. This figure was up by 7.15% from the exports of $161.4m in the same period last year.

U. A. E. Dubai was the fourth in line as exports to the region during the aforementioned period were $134.02m, depicting an increase of 24.23% YoY.

Among other countries, Pakistan's exports to Germany stood at $125.11m, marking a drop of 10.29% YoY, while exports to Spain increased by 3.32% YoY to $122.27m.

Moreover, the export receipts received from the Netherlands (Holland) stood at $111.93m, down by 6.17% YoY.

In the month of November alone, the total exports to U. S. A. dropped by 10.31% MoM. Similarly, exports to China dropped by 14.91% MoM.

Moreover, receipts received from exports to U. K. depicted an increase of 1.35% MoM.

Meanwhile, cumulatively, in 5MFY24, U. S. A. was the top source of export receipts, worth $2.3bn as against the total exports worth $2.61bn in 5MFY23.

Whereas, total exports to China in 5MFY24 stood at $1.22bn, registering an increase of 39.44%.

Cumulatively, U. K. ranked as the third-largest contributor to the country's export earnings, accounting for exports valued at $862.4m in 5MFY24, compared to $847.07m in 5MFY23
